Transaction 80fec5101d1caf3f68ed75e7debdea2907dd3d9cb62042d2dba1b4c250c2276f
1 Input
1 Output
-
80fec5101d1caf3f68ed75e7debdea2907dd3d9cb62042d2dba1b4c250c2276f:0
- value
- 739104
- script pubkey
- OP_0 OP_PUSHBYTES_20 89677cb9b6af0ae2d6cfc1437efa44182dad0f15
- address
- bc1q39nhewdk4u9w94k0c9pha7jyrqk66rc4yhd62g